Suicide can be preventedTeen suicide it is a very serious problem that needs a lot of attention. The newspapers and news channels should try to make it a main topic more often.
People need to know that this isnt an insignificant topic; everyone has to do their part to prevent it. Many people have lost a loved one to teen suicide. It could have been a brother, a sister, a cousin, or even a best friend.
I am glad there are organizations out there specifically focusing on suicide. Some people just need a safe environment where they can express themselves, and that is exactly what these organizations provide.
I understand how sometimes teenagers feel extremely stressed and try to push themselves to live up to their own, and sometimes others, expectations. A lot of stress can just make a person feel down and alone. Sometimes bullying can even be a contributing factor.
We teenagers tend to focus on the now, and not the future. We believe that the problems we have now will never go away and we will always be facing that one problem; however, that is certainly not the case. People need to know this can be prevented and Im glad the news is starting to raise awareness.
